Utilization of carbide slag in autoclaved aerated concrete (CS-AAC) and optimization: Foaming, hydration process, and physic-mechanical properties
Autoclaved aerated concrete (AAC), a lightweight porous material, has been widely used in the building field because of its energy savings. A solid waste called carbide slag with a high Ca(OH)2 content is a potential substitution for CaO to prepare AAC. In this study, carbide slag was used to replac...
